Understanding Your Car’s AC System
Before attempting to recharge your car’s AC, it’s important to understand how it works. Your car’s AC system is a closed loop that circulates refrigerant, a special fluid that absorbs heat from the air inside your car and releases it outside. The system consists of several key components:
Key Components of a Car’s AC System:
- Compressor: This component pressurizes the refrigerant, increasing its temperature and allowing it to absorb heat.
- Condenser: Located at the front of the car, the condenser releases the heat absorbed by the refrigerant into the surrounding air.
- Expansion Valve: This valve regulates the flow of refrigerant into the evaporator, causing it to cool down significantly.
- Evaporator: Located inside the car’s dashboard, the evaporator absorbs heat from the air passing over it, cooling the air and blowing it into the cabin.
- Refrigerant: This special fluid circulates through the system, absorbing and releasing heat to maintain the desired temperature.
These components work together to create a continuous cycle that cools the air inside your car. When the refrigerant level is low, the system cannot function efficiently, resulting in warm air blowing from the vents.
Signs Your Car’s AC Needs Recharging
Knowing the signs of a low refrigerant level is crucial for addressing the issue promptly. Ignoring a low refrigerant problem can lead to further damage and costly repairs. Here are some common signs that your car’s AC needs recharging:
Signs of Low Refrigerant:
- Warm Air Blowing from Vents: This is the most obvious sign of a low refrigerant level. If your AC is blowing warm air instead of cold, it’s likely that the refrigerant level is low.
- Weak Airflow: If the airflow from your vents seems weak, even when the AC is on high, it could indicate a refrigerant leak or low pressure in the system.
- Hissing Sounds: A hissing sound coming from the AC system, especially around the compressor or hoses, could indicate a refrigerant leak.
- AC Compressor Cycling On and Off Frequently: If your AC compressor cycles on and off rapidly, it could be struggling to maintain the desired pressure due to low refrigerant.
- Frost Build-Up on Evaporator Coils: While frost build-up can indicate other issues, it can also be a sign of low refrigerant, as the evaporator coils may be working too hard to cool the air.

How to Recharge Your Car’s AC System
Recharging your car’s AC system involves adding refrigerant to the system to bring the pressure back to the optimal level. While it may seem straightforward, it’s important to note that this process requires specialized tools and knowledge. Attempting to recharge your AC system without proper training and equipment can be dangerous and potentially damage your system.
Tools and Materials Needed:
- Refrigerant Canister: Choose the correct refrigerant type for your car model. Consult your owner’s manual or a mechanic for the specific type.
- AC Recharge Kit: This kit typically includes a hose with gauges, a charging valve, and other necessary adapters.
- Gloves and Safety Glasses: Protect yourself from refrigerant contact and potential leaks.
Steps for Recharging Your Car’s AC System:
- Locate the Low-Pressure Service Port: This port is usually located on the evaporator housing or near the condenser. Consult your owner’s manual for the exact location.
- Connect the Recharge Kit Hoses: Carefully connect the hoses from the recharge kit to the low-pressure service port. Ensure a tight seal to prevent refrigerant leaks.
- Check the Refrigerant Pressure: Use the gauges on the recharge kit to check the refrigerant pressure in the system. Refer to your owner’s manual for the recommended pressure range.
- Add Refrigerant Gradually: Slowly release refrigerant from the canister into the system, monitoring the pressure gauge closely. Add refrigerant in small increments to avoid overcharging the system.
- Disconnect and Reconnect Hoses: Once the desired pressure is reached, disconnect the hoses from the service port and carefully remove any excess refrigerant from the hoses.
- Start the Engine and Test the AC System: Turn on your car’s AC system and allow it to run for a few minutes. Check the airflow and temperature to ensure the system is functioning properly.
If the AC system is still not cooling effectively after recharging, it’s important to have the system inspected by a qualified mechanic to diagnose and repair any underlying issues.

Frequently Asked Questions
What type of refrigerant does my car use?
The type of refrigerant your car uses depends on its make, model, and year. You can find this information in your owner’s manual or by contacting a qualified mechanic. (See Also: What Does A Bad Car Ac Compressor Sound Like? – Listen For These Signs)
How often should I recharge my car’s AC?
Most car AC systems don’t require regular recharging. However, it’s a good idea to have your system inspected annually by a mechanic to check for leaks and ensure proper operation.
Can I recharge my car’s AC myself?
While it’s possible to recharge your car’s AC yourself, it’s highly recommended to have it done by a qualified mechanic. Refrigerants are hazardous materials, and improper handling can damage your system or pose a safety risk.
What are the symptoms of a leaking AC system?
Common symptoms of a leaking AC system include warm air blowing from the vents, weak airflow, hissing sounds, and frost build-up on the evaporator coils.
How much does it cost to recharge my car’s AC?
The cost of recharging your car’s AC can vary depending on the type of refrigerant used, the severity of the leak, and the location of the service. Generally, expect to pay between $100 and $300 for a recharge. (See Also: Car Makes Rattling Noise When Ac Is on? Common Causes Revealed)
